Introducing Social Proximity

For the most part, Proximity Marketing is just an extension of the online world. Banners on mobile browsers try to entice customers to click on them.

Whereas Social Proximity is about empowering the subscriber to dictate what they want and don't want, the groups they are interested in participating in and the degree to which their personal infomration is published. Social Proximity is about user generated content and targeted delivery. This works for both advertisers and for Social Proximity subscribers and provides and even playing field for subscribers to control and interact with the commercial world without the risk of being spammed or exposing their personal information.

 

While "SMS is by far the most popular technology for mobile marketing right now, it is not targeted to the subscriber and is simply spamming. Media Bank is a hosted ad serving solution that can tailor media delivery to an individual subscriber's opt-in preferences. In return, subscribers receive cash vouchers, free SMS or free voice calls.

 

The Media Bank advertising revenue model is performance based whereby advertisers pay performance-based fees such as cost-per-order, cost-per-lead or cost-per-click, which are not unlike the online world. Cost-per-impression options are also possible for non-performance based campaigns where a brand is looking for brand awareness rather than an immediate response.

 

Social Proximity must be augmented by Proximity Signage and physical signage in order to be effective in a commercial sense because "Virtual” advertising is not visible unless you are tuned into this channel.

 

Social Proximity is an excellent medium for niche groups with specific interests to share information and to create virtual communities and when combined with the opt-in control, there is a clear market for using these channels for highly targeted advertising where an advertiser has something of interest for that specific group.
